  • Realme 16 5G has launched with a 7,000mAh battery, setting a new benchmark for budget phones in India.
  • IP69-rated durability could attract users concerned about device longevity in varied conditions.
  • Comparative studies indicate clear shifts in preferences towards extended battery life and enhanced durability features.

What changed

The launch of the Realme 16 5G introduces a 7,000mAh battery and IP69-rated durability, directly challenging the Nothing Phone 4a Pro's market position.

Why we think this could happen

Expect a shift in market preferences towards smartphones like the Realme 16 5G and Poco X8 Pro, particularly among cost-sensitive buyers in India.

Historical context

Budget smartphones have consistently competed on battery life and durability, often swaying consumer decisions in favor of brands that excel in these areas.
